.module-featured-posts .swiper-slide{border-bottom-right-radius:40px;overflow:hidden;position:relative}.module-featured-posts .swiper-slide:focus .hover-content,.module-featured-posts .swiper-slide:hover .hover-content{opacity:1;visibility:visible}.module-featured-posts .swiper-slide .hover-content,.module-featured-posts .swiper-slide .nonhover-content{padding:30px 28px}.module-featured-posts .swiper-slide .ace-figure .placeholder{padding-bottom:60.5%}.module-featured-posts .swiper-slide .eyebrow{color:#676767;font-family:GothamSSm,sans-serif;font-size:.77em;font-weight:700;text-transform:uppercase}.module-featured-posts .swiper-slide .post-title{color:#036;font-weight:700;line-height:1.2;margin-bottom:45px}.module-featured-posts .swiper-slide .post-excerpt{color:#fff;font-size:.88em;font-weight:300}.module-featured-posts .swiper-slide .button{margin-top:auto}.module-featured-posts .swiper-slide .nonhover-content{background-color:#eaeaea;padding-bottom:0;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1}.module-featured-posts .swiper-slide .hover-content{display:-webkit-box;display:-ms-flexbox;display:flex;height:100%;left:0;position:absolute;top:0;z-index:2;-webkit-box-orient:vertical;-webkit-box-direction:normal;background-color:#036;-ms-flex-direction:column;flex-direction:column;opacity:0;overflow:auto;-webkit-transition:opacity .3s,visibility .3s;transition:opacity .3s,visibility .3s;visibility:hidden}.module-featured-posts .swiper-slide .hover-content .eyebrow{color:#77cbf2}.module-featured-posts .swiper-slide .hover-content .post-title{color:#fff;margin-bottom:23px}